Laurel's Climate Is Hard on Decks — Here's Why

Laurel sits in a stretch of Whatcom County that gets the full weather package: moisture-laden air off the Salish Sea, long stretches of driving rain through fall and winter, and short, weak winter daylight that keeps shaded surfaces damp for weeks at a time. Add in the salt air that drifts inland from the coast and you've got conditions that quietly attack wood, fasteners, and even some composite products faster than most manufacturers' literature assumes.

A deck built for a drier inland climate, or built without attention to drainage and ventilation underneath, tends to show its age in this area within a handful of years — not decades. Soft spots near ledger boards, corroded fasteners, and a green film of moss on anything that doesn't get direct sun are the most common complaints we hear from homeowners in and around Laurel. None of that is inevitable. It's a sign the original build didn't account for what this specific climate does to a structure over time.

Signs Your Laurel Deck Needs Replacement, Not Repair

Not every tired-looking deck needs to come out. But there's a point where patching boards is just delaying an inevitable, more expensive fix — and in some cases, patching over a structural problem is a safety risk. Replacement is usually the right call when:

  • The frame or ledger board is soft, spongy, or shows rot when probed with a screwdriver
  • Fasteners are rusted, bleeding stains into the wood, or backing out
  • The deck was never properly flashed where it meets the house, and you can see water staining on the siding or rim joist below
  • Footings have shifted, heaved, or settled unevenly, causing the deck to feel bouncy or slope
  • Moss and algae keep returning within weeks of cleaning, meaning the surface is staying damp longer than it should
  • The deck predates current guardrail and stair-baluster spacing standards and would need a full rebuild to bring up to code anyway

If it's just surface graying or a few worn boards on an otherwise sound frame, a repair or resurfacing may be all that's needed. We'll tell you honestly which category your deck falls into rather than push a full tear-out you don't need.

What a Correct Deck Replacement Involves

A deck is only as good as the parts you can't see once it's finished. Most deck failures in this climate start below the decking boards, not on top of them.

Framing and Ledger Attachment

Where the deck attaches to the house is the single most important detail on the whole project. It needs proper flashing that sheds water away from the house framing, correct structural fasteners (not just deck screws) rated for the load, and a gap or flashing detail that keeps water from wicking into the rim joist. This is the area we find neglected most often on older builds, and it's usually the source of hidden rot.

Drainage and Ventilation

Decks that trap moisture underneath — low clearance to grade, no slope away from the house, dense landscaping crowding the perimeter — stay wet longer after every rain event and grow moss and mildew faster. A correct rebuild accounts for grading, clearance, and airflow underneath so the structure actually gets a chance to dry out between storms.

Fasteners and Hardware

Salt-air corrosion is real here, even set back from the water. Standard galvanized hardware can start showing rust streaks within a few seasons. We use fasteners and structural connectors rated for coastal/high-moisture exposure — typically stainless steel or heavy-duty coated hardware matched to the decking material — because replacing a deck's structure due to failed fasteners is far more expensive than spending correctly on hardware the first time.

Choosing Decking Material for Whatcom County Weather

There's no single "best" decking material — there's a best fit for your budget, your maintenance appetite, and how much sun versus shade your deck actually gets. Here's how the common options hold up under Laurel's conditions specifically:

MaterialMoss/Moisture BehaviorMaintenanceTypical LifespanRelative Cost
Pressure-treated woodAbsorbs moisture, needs regular sealing to resist moss and grayingAnnual cleaning and periodic re-staining/sealing10–15 years with upkeepLowest upfront
CedarNaturally rot-resistant but still needs sealing in shaded, damp spotsRegular sealing to maintain color and resistance15–20 years with upkeepMid
CompositeWon't rot, but can still grow surface moss/algae in shaded areas without cleaningPeriodic washing, no sealing/staining25+ yearsMid to high
PVC/capped compositeMost resistant to moisture absorption; still benefits from occasional cleaning in shaded spotsLowest — occasional washing25–30+ yearsHighest upfront

For decks in heavily shaded or north-facing spots common on treed Laurel lots, we lean toward recommending composite or capped-composite boards, simply because moss and algae take hold faster on organic wood surfaces that don't get direct sun. For decks with good sun exposure, a well-maintained wood deck can still be a smart, budget-friendly choice.

Permits, Code, and Safety Basics

Deck replacement projects above certain heights or involving structural changes typically require a permit through the local building jurisdiction, and guardrail height, baluster spacing, and stair details all need to meet current residential code — not whatever standard was in place when an older deck was originally built. Footing depth and design also need to account for local frost and soil conditions rather than a generic spec pulled off the internet.

We handle the permit and inspection process as part of the job rather than leaving it to the homeowner to sort out. If your existing deck predates current code, that's normal — it just means the replacement is also your opportunity to bring the structure up to current safety standards in the same project.

Keeping Your New Deck Ahead of Moss and Moisture

A properly built deck still needs some seasonal attention in this climate. A few habits go a long way toward protecting the investment:

  • Sweep debris and fallen leaves off the deck regularly through fall — trapped organic matter holds moisture and feeds moss
  • Wash the surface at least once a year, more often in heavily shaded areas, to remove early moss and algae growth before it takes hold
  • Keep gutters and downspouts clear so overflow isn't draining directly onto or under the deck
  • Trim back landscaping that's crowding the deck perimeter and blocking airflow underneath
  • Reseal wood decking on the schedule recommended for your specific product — don't wait until it's visibly gray and worn
  • Check fasteners and railings annually for early rust or looseness, especially after a hard winter

How long does a typical full deck replacement take?

Most residential deck replacements take anywhere from a few days to about two weeks, depending on deck size, framing complexity, and whether permit inspections add scheduling gaps. Weather is also a factor here, since extended rain can slow tear-out and finishing work. We'll give you a realistic timeline as part of the estimate, not a rushed guess.

What should I ask a contractor before hiring them for a deck replacement in this area?

Ask whether they'll pull the required permit, what fastener and hardware grade they use given local moisture and salt-air exposure, and whether they inspect the ledger and framing before quoting a price. Also ask for their approach to drainage and ventilation underneath the deck, since that's what determines how well it holds up here long-term. A contractor who can answer these specifically, rather than generically, is a good sign.

Should I choose composite or real wood decking for a home near Lynden?

It depends mainly on how much shade your deck gets and how much upkeep you want to do. Composite and capped-composite products resist moisture and moss better in shaded, damp spots and need less maintenance, while a well-maintained wood deck in a sunnier location can perform well at a lower upfront cost. We'll walk through the trade-offs based on your specific site during the estimate.

What kind of fasteners and hardware actually hold up in this climate?

Standard galvanized fasteners can start corroding within a few seasons in this region's damp, salt-tinged air, especially on ledger connections and railings. We use stainless steel or heavy-duty coated structural fasteners rated for coastal and high-moisture exposure, matched to whichever decking material you choose. Spending correctly on hardware upfront avoids much costlier structural repairs later.

Does Laurel's soil or terrain create any special considerations for deck footings?

Footing design always needs to account for local soil drainage and frost depth rather than a one-size-fits-all approach, and rural and semi-rural lots around Laurel can vary quite a bit in soil composition and drainage from one property to the next. We evaluate footing placement and depth on-site rather than assuming a generic spec will hold, and any structural footing work is handled through the proper permit and inspection process.
